Hialeah's First Craft Brewery Unbranded Brewing to Close After Four Years
After four years in East Hialeah, award-winning craft brewery Unbranded Brewing will close its doors on Saturday, August 31. On Tuesday, July 23, the brewery released a statement on Instagram that now has more than 400 comments and nearly 3,000 likes from regulars and fans of the craft brewery expressing their devastation to see the brewery go.
On the water, be aware of divers-down flags
The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ission reminds boaters and divers boaters and divers to use — and be on the lookout for — divers-down flags. FWC encourages the practice of safe boating and diving habits by maintaining 360-degree awareness and adhering to all divers-down flag regulations.
